On Sep 24, 2004, at 6:02 AM, Edward Neville wrote:
How can I limit the domain's quota to X bytes rather than limiting a user's
disk as I would prefer to have our customers set up a large number of mail
boxes but not letting the domain go over a given size.

Vpopmail has domain quotas, but they're broken. Even if/when they do work, they add a lot of load since vdelivermail has to calculate the domain's disk usage every time a message is delivered.


I didn't write the original implementation, I don't use them myself, and I'm not particularly interested in finding the problem and fixing it.
